Roma want the future of Liverpool and Chelsea target Alisson decided by the end of July.
The Times are reporting that the Italian team are desperate to sort out the future of their superstar stopper ASAP with the transfer window closing earlier than in previous years. Liverpool, Chelsea and Real Madrid have been linked with a move for the Brazilian for some time now and it now appears as if the patience of Roma is starting to wear thin.
The transfer window shuts before the season starts across Europe this season and that means teams are eager to get these deals across the line earlier than usual. Transfer speculation has ramped up a notch since the end of the World Cup and a host of goalkeepers could be on the move if rumours are to be believed.
New Chelsea boss Maurizio Sarri is believed to want the 25-year-old at Stamford Bridge should Thibaut Courtos move to Real Madrid as is being widely reported over the last few days.
Liverpool FC have been linked with a move for Alisson for what seems like an eternity but Jurgen Klopp is so far yet to make a move into the market this summer to replace the struggling Loris Karius. The German dropped two almighty clangers in the Champions League Final back in May and it would be a major surprise if we didn't see a new shot stopper arrive at Anfield sooner, rather than later.
Roma clearly have had enough of the speculation and want an end to the saga as soon as possible and who can blame them with the new season fast approaching on the horizon
The Giallorossi must be putting plans in place behind the scenes to replace one of their star players and if this latest report is to be believed, then we could be set to see one of the longest running transfer sagas of the summer come to an end.
